Regulatory Compliance and Licensing

Most prominent operators are licensed and regulated by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), which ensures adherence to strict standards of fairness, security, and responsible gambling. Operators that hold these licenses are subjected to periodic audits and transparency requirements. This reduces the risk of fraudulent activity or unfair practices, making them more trustworthy options for players.

Trade-Offs and Considerations

While these sites excel in many aspects, players should remain aware of some limitations. High bonus wagering requirements, withdrawal limits, or restrictions on certain payment methods can affect overall experience.

For example, some platforms may impose a £10,000 monthly withdrawal cap, which could impact high-stakes players. Additionally, certain bonuses are eligible only for slots, excluding other game types.
